Chapter 11 - Infinite Sequences and Series - 11.2 Exercises - Page 735: 21

Answer

60

Work Step by Step

The values in the sequence are getting smaller and smaller in a geometric sequence. When we divide consecutive terms, we see we have a common ratio of 0.9. We can use the formula $S_{y}=a/(1-r)$, where a is the first term and r is the ratio between terms. $S_y=6/(1-0.9)=6/0.1=60$
